How to Grow Shrubby Honeysuckles Bonsai
Growing a Shrubby Honeysuckles bonsai is easy. Follow these steps to get started.
1. Choose The Right Pot
Select a pot with good drainage. A shallow pot works best for bonsai.
2. Select Healthy Plant
Choose a healthy Shrubby Honeysuckle plant. Look for vibrant leaves and strong stems.
3. Prepare The Soil
Use well-draining soil. Bonsai soil mixes are available at garden centers.
4. Planting The Bonsai
Place the plant in the pot. Add soil around the roots and press down gently.
5. Watering
Water the bonsai regularly. The soil should be moist but not soggy.
6. Sunlight
Shrubby Honeysuckles need plenty of sunlight. Place them in a sunny spot.
Caring for Your Shrubby Honeysuckles Bonsai
Proper care is essential for a healthy bonsai. Here are some tips to keep your bonsai in top shape.
Pruning
Prune your bonsai to maintain its shape. Remove dead or overgrown branches.
Feeding
Feed your bonsai with a balanced fertilizer. Do this every four weeks during the growing season.
Pest Control
Watch for pests like aphids and spider mites. Use insecticidal soap if needed.

Common Problems and Solutions
Even with the best care, problems can arise. Here are some common issues and how to solve them.
Problem | Solution |
---|---|
Yellow Leaves | Check for overwatering or poor drainage. Adjust watering habits. |
Leaf Drop | Ensure the plant gets enough light. Avoid sudden temperature changes. |
Pest Infestation | Use insecticidal soap or neem oil. Keep the plant clean. |
Slow Growth | Feed the plant with balanced fertilizer. Check soil quality. |
